Transaction 521fc111b4aff5b95d09a26266b8038b976f7d53d321bb7a1dcd7a27e94c9531

2 Input
2 Outputs
  • 521fc111b4aff5b95d09a26266b8038b976f7d53d321bb7a1dcd7a27e94c9531:0
  • value  13930796
    address  mhh6Dsv72LmiWPoRFXeFz4uR3hu4Df3yKV
  • 521fc111b4aff5b95d09a26266b8038b976f7d53d321bb7a1dcd7a27e94c9531:1
  • value  13989888
    address  mifrM9PeFWPGFRt876cdvrVt5GvKSgHWs4